Buckeye Bernese Mountain Dog Club – CONSTITUTION

Section 1. The name of the club shall be:   Buckeye Bernese Mountain Dog Club

Section 2.  Objectives of this Club shall be:
a)        To provide education appropriate to the needs of owners, breeders, potential owners and all others with
        an interest in pure bred Bernese Mountain Dogs.
b)        To provide events/gatherings for our members to enjoy the breed and learn about such subjects as
        nutrition, training, agility, rally, obedience, drafting, grooming, and health of Bernese Mountain Dogs.
c)        To do all in its power to protect and advance the interests of the breed by encouraging sportsmanlike
        competition at dog shows, obedience and rally trials and any event for which the Club is eligible under
        the Rules and Regulations of The American Kennel Club and at draft tests under the rules of the Bernese
        Mountain Dog Club of America (BMDCA).
d)        To conduct sanctioned matches, dog shows, obedience and rally trials and any other event for which the
       Club is eligible under the Rules and Regulations of The American Kennel Club and to conduct draft tests
       under the rules of the Bernese Mountain Dog Club of America.
e)         To encourage all members and breeders to accept the standard of the breed as approved by The
         American Kennel Club as the only standard of excellence by which Bernese Mountain Dogs shall be judged.
f)         To do all that is possible to improve the health of the breed; and
g)        To encourage and promote quality in the breeding of pure-bred Bernese Mountain Dogs.

Section 3.  This club shall not be conducted or operated for profit.  No part of any profits or residues from dues or
donation to the Club shall inure to the benefit of any member or individual

Section 4.  Bylaws shall be adopted and may from time to time be revised by the members as required to carry out
these objectives.
